James McKenzie and the Diman football team played with a sense of urgency on Thursday night.
The end result, a resounding road win over league opponent Southeastern.
"No matters who's in the game, you have to come with energy," said McKenzie after the Bengals rolled to a 35-7 victory over the Hawks. "Eleven guys to the football. That's what we're coached to do. Coach Bahry and coach Valente express that every day."
It was a total team effort on offense, defense and special teams.
